Explore New Combinations

“I would start by shifting your mindset from ‘routine’ to ‘reinvention.’

Instead of relying on the same combinations, really challenge yourself to try new pairings,” Taghinia says.

Experiment with different textures and proportions, such as combining oversize and well-fitted pieces or faux fur with leather.
